The Contracting Parties,
Considering that EUROFISH was established with the assistance of FAO as an independent international organisation by an agreement, adopted by a Conference of Plenipotentiaries convened by the Director-General of FAO on 23 May 2000, which entered into force on 12 October 2001, and for which the Director-General of FAO is the Depositary;
Considering that Article 13, paragraph 1 of the Agreement for the Establishment of the International Organisation for the Development of Fisheries in Eastern and Central Europe (EUROFISH) provides that “there should be a working relationship between EUROFISH and the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. To this end, EUROFISH shall enter into negotiations with the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ations with a view to concluding an agreement pursuant to Article XIII of the Constitution of the Organization. Such agreement should provide, inter alia, for the Director-General of FAO to appoint a Representative who would participate in all meetings of EUROFISH, but without the right to vote”;
Considering also that the Governing Council of EUROFISH, at its First Regular Session, on 20 and 21 January 2002, decided that EUROFISH would enter into negotiations with FAO with a view to formalizing the cooperation between the two organizations;
Considering further that Article XIII, paragraph 1 of the FAO Constitution states that “in order to provide for close cooperation between the Organization and other international organizations with related responsibilities, the Conference may enter into agreements with the competent authorities of such organizations, defining the distribution of responsibilities and methods of cooperation”;
Recognizing the interest which FAO has in the promotion of cooperation for the development of fisheries in Eastern and Central Europe and in supporting the objectives of EUROFISH.
Have agreed as follows:
EUROFISH shall be invited to participate in the sessions of the
Conference and the Council of FAO, the Committee on Fisheries (COFI), the COFI
Sub-Committee on Aquaculture, the COFI Sub-Committee on Trade, the FAO
Regional Conference for Europe and the European Inland Fisheries Advisory
Commission, in an observer capacity.
Entry into force
The present Agreement shall enter into force as soon as it has been approved by the appropriate Governing Bodies of both organizations.
THE CONFERENCE,
Recalling the decision taken by the Council, at its Hundred and Twenty-third Session, held from 28 October to 1 November 2002, regarding the question of the number and length of terms of office of the Director-General, Article VII.1 of the Constitution;
Having considered that, at its Hundred and Twenty-fourth Session, held from 23 to 28 June 2003, the Council accepted the report of the Group of “Friends of the Chair”, document CL 124/INF/22, and agreed to transmit the proposed amendment to Article VII.1 of the Constitution that the “Director-General should be appointed for a term o f six years, renewable only once for a further term of four years”, to the Committee on Constitutional and Legal Matters, at its Seventy-fifth Session, in October 2003, along with document CL 124/INF/22 before being submitted to the Thirty-second Session of the Conference for adoption;
Having further considered the report of the Seventy-fifth Session of the Committee on Constitutional and Legal Matters, held on 6 and 7 October 2003, as well as the Report of the Hundred and Twenty-fifth Session of the Council, held from 26 to 28 November 2003;
1. Decides to amend Article VII, paragraph 1, of the Constitution as follows:
“1. There shall be a Director-General of the Organization who shall be appointed by the Conference for a term of six years. He shall be eligible for reappointment only once for a further term of four years.”
2. Decides that the revision of Article VII, paragraph 1, of the Constitution shall apply to the election at the Thirty-third Session of the Conference in 2005 and govern the mandates of the Directors-General from 1 January 2006.
(Adopted on ... December 2003)
THE CONFERENCE,
Recalling that the Finance Committee, at its Hundred-and-second Session, held from 5 to 9 May 2003, endorsed a proposal that the Financial Regulations be amended in order to reflect the requirement that the Director-General, when entering into negotiations with concerned governments and national institutions, in connection with Funds under Partnership in Development Agreements should satisfy himself that adequate controls are in place;
Noting that the Committee on Constitutional and Legal Matters, at its Seventy-fifth Session, held on 6 and 7 October 2003, reviewed the proposed amendment to the Financial Regulations;
Noting further that the Council, at its Hundred and Twenty-fifth Session, held from 26 to 28 November 2003, approved the proposed amendment and recommended its adoption by the Conference at its Thirty-second Session;
1. Adopts new Financial Regulation 6.8, as follows:
“The Director-General may enter into agreements with governments and donors providing for technical assistance in the context of development projects to be executed/ implemented by the beneficiary government or other national entity. Under these modalities, referred to below as projects under Partnership in Development Agreements, the following shall apply:
(a) Where the funds are to be held and managed by the government or other national entity under national execution or implementation arrangements, FAO’s participation shall be separately reported to the Finance Committee as Funds under Partnership in Development Agreements, and such funds shall not be included in the Financial Statements of the Organization.
(b) Where the funds are to be held in trust by FAO and transferred to the government or other national entity for the implementation of agreed activities, the funds shall be reported to the Finance Committee in the Financial Statements of the Organization as Funds held in Trust on behalf of beneficiary governments under Partnership in Development Agreements and shall be subject to the internal and external auditing procedures of the Organization. Funds held in trust by FAO that are subject to national implementation shall be expended in accordance with the national regulations and rules of the implementing government and shall be subject to certification by the responsible national authorities, provided that the Director-General shall satisfy himself before entering into the agreement with the government that such regulations and rules are consistent with the Financial Regulations of the Organization and provide adequate controls over the expenditure of the funds. These projects under Partnership in Development Agreements shall be subject to audit at least once a year by an independent auditor appointed with the agreement of both the government concerned and the Organization in accordance with the respective agreements.”
2. Decides that subsequent paragraphs of Financial Regulation VI are to be re-numbered accordingly.
(Adopted on ... December 2003)
